Why Chipped Step Edges Matter

Concrete steps endure constant traffic, freeze-thaw cycles, de-icing salts, and impact from deliveries or furniture. The leading edge, or nosing, takes the brunt of that abuse. Once the edge chips, two things happen quickly:

  • The exposed aggregate and broken surface collect water.
  • That water freezes, expands, and pries off more concrete.

What started as a cosmetic flaw becomes a structural and safety issue. A rounded or missing nosing changes the effective tread depth and creates an irregular landing point for the foot. For older adults, children, and guests unfamiliar with the stairs, that irregularity is a genuine fall risk.

Repairing the chip early stops the cycle, restores a crisp walking edge, and protects the rest of the step from further deterioration. Done correctly, the patched area can last many years and blend with the original concrete.

Assessing the Damage: Repair or Replace?

Not every chip belongs in the “patch it” category. A careful look at the step tells you which path to take.

Repair is usually appropriate when:

  • The chip is limited to the nosing or a small corner.
  • The remaining concrete is sound—no deep cracks running through the tread or riser.
  • The step still feels solid underfoot with no hollow sound when tapped.
  • The damage does not extend under the tread into the supporting structure.

Replacement should be considered when:

  • Multiple steps show widespread crumbling or large missing sections.
  • Cracks run from the chip down the riser or across the tread.
  • The steps have settled, tilted, or separated from the landing.
  • Previous patches have already failed.
  • The original mix was poor and the entire flight is scaling or spalling.

If you are unsure, a professional inspection is inexpensive compared with the cost of a failed DIY patch or an injury. When the concrete itself is still competent, a well-executed concrete step repair restores both function and appearance at a fraction of the cost of tearing out and pouring new steps.

Tools and Materials You Will Need

Gather everything before you start. Working with a wet mix on a vertical edge leaves little time to hunt for a missing tool.

Essential materials

  • Concrete cleaner or mild detergent and a stiff brush
  • Concrete bonding agent (liquid latex or acrylic type formulated for vertical surfaces)
  • Pre-mixed concrete repair mix or polymer-modified patching compound rated for exterior steps
  • Clean water (measured, not guessed)
  • Form board or reusable edge form if the nosing must be rebuilt to full profile
  • Release agent or plastic sheeting for the form

Tools

  • Wire brush, chisel, and hammer for removing loose material
  • Shop vacuum or compressed air
  • Margin trowel, pointing trowel, and wood or magnesium float
  • Mixing bucket, drill with paddle, or mixing hoe
  • Spray bottle for misting during cure
  • Safety glasses, gloves, and knee pads

Choose a repair product labeled for vertical and overhead use if the chip is on the face of the riser as well as the nosing. Standard sack concrete is too coarse and shrinks too much for this job.

Safety First

Work on a dry day with temperatures between 50 °F and 80 °F if possible. Wear eye protection when chipping loose concrete. Keep the work area clear so no one walks on wet patch material. If the steps are the only entrance, plan a temporary alternate route or schedule the work when traffic is light.

Step-by-Step Repair Process

The sequence is simple, but each stage must be done thoroughly. Skipping preparation is the most common reason patches fail.

1. Clean the Damaged Area

Remove every piece of loose or unsound concrete. Use a hammer and cold chisel to undercut the edges of the chip slightly so the new material has a mechanical key. Wire-brush the surface until only hard, clean concrete remains. Vacuum or blow out dust. Wash with a concrete cleaner if oil, paint, or efflorescence is present, then rinse and allow the area to dry to a damp, not dripping, condition. A clean, slightly rough surface is what the bonding agent and patch need to grip.

2. Apply Bonding Agent

Brush or roll a thin, even coat of bonding agent onto the prepared concrete. Do not let it puddle or dry to a hard film. Most products work best when the patch is applied while the bonding agent is still tacky. This chemical bridge is what prevents the new material from simply sitting on top of the old concrete and later popping off. Follow the manufacturer’s open time exactly.

3. Patch with Concrete Repair Mix

Mix the repair compound to a stiff, peanut-butter consistency—wet enough to pack tightly but dry enough to stay in place on a vertical edge. Over-watering is a frequent mistake that leads to shrinkage cracks and a weak surface. Pack the mix firmly into the void with a trowel, working from the back of the cavity forward so no air pockets remain. Overfill slightly; you will strike it off later.

If the nosing is completely missing, set a form board at the correct projection and height, braced so it cannot shift. Coat the form with a release agent so it does not bond to the fresh patch.

4. Shape the Edge

Once the material has begun to firm (usually 15–45 minutes depending on temperature and mix), strike off the excess and recreate the original profile. Use the trowel to match the existing nosing radius or square edge. A wood float can produce a slightly textured surface that blends with broom-finished treads. Keep the new edge slightly proud of the surrounding concrete; you can dress it after initial set. The goal is a continuous walking line that feels the same underfoot as the undamaged steps.

5. Cure the Repair

Curing is not optional. Concrete gains strength through hydration, not drying. Mist the patch lightly, cover with plastic sheeting, or apply a curing compound according to the product instructions. Protect the area from foot traffic, rain, and freezing for the time specified—often 24 to 72 hours for light use and longer for full strength. Rapid drying in sun or wind produces a weak, dusty surface that will chip again.

Common Mistakes That Cause Patches to Fail

Even a good mix will fail if the basics are ignored.

  • Leaving dust or loose particles in the cavity.
  • Applying patch to a bone-dry or soaking-wet surface.
  • Mixing too wet so the material slumps and shrinks.
  • Skipping the bonding agent.
  • Walking on the repair too soon.
  • Failing to protect the patch from rain or frost during the first day.

A patch that looks perfect on day one but crumbles six months later almost always traces back to one of these errors.

After the Repair: Maintenance and Longevity

Once cured, treat the repaired steps like any other exterior concrete. Sweep regularly. Avoid metal snow shovels that can nick the new edge. Use a concrete-safe de-icer rather than rock salt if possible. A breathable penetrating sealer applied after the patch has fully cured (usually 28 days) adds an extra layer of protection against water and freeze-thaw damage.

Inspect the steps each spring. Catching a new hairline chip early keeps the repair small and inexpensive.

When Professional Help Makes Sense

Homeowners comfortable with masonry work can handle a single small chip. Larger missing sections, multiple steps, or any doubt about the soundness of the remaining concrete are better left to a crew that does this work daily. Professionals bring the right mix designs, forming systems, and curing practices, and they stand behind the result. They can also evaluate whether hidden issues—poor drainage, settlement, or inadequate original thickness—need attention at the same time.

The Payoff: Safety, Appearance, and Value

A crisp, level nosing does more than look tidy. It restores the designed tread depth, gives the foot a predictable landing, and removes a common trip point. Water no longer sits in a broken edge and works its way into the step. The entrance looks cared-for instead of worn. For a relatively modest investment of time and material, the repair protects both the people who use the stairs and the concrete itself.

Ignoring chips is the expensive option. What begins as a two-hour patch can become a full flight replacement if freeze-thaw and traffic are allowed to continue the damage.
